A behind the scenes look at how a production crew tells the story of a nationally televised football broadcast and in-arena show. Consider the production crew has no idea what will happen for approximately 3 ½ hours with millions of people watching. In this talk, the business acumen needed to work on a nationally televised sporting event will be shared. They include the ability to make split second decisions, time management and organizational skills, practical skills to understand the different jobs, and creative problem solving on the fly.

Albert Dupont, Jr.
Technology Coordinator | Loyola University
Albert Dupont is the technology coordinator for the Loyola University School of Communication and Design in New Orleans overseeing the broadcast operations and studios. He has worked for over 30 years in sports videography and production and 18 years in education.
Albert started his broadcast career as a producer at KATC in Lafayette, then moved to WAFB in Baton Rouge. Albert ended his commercial broadcast career at WVUE in New Orleans as a sports and news videographer. After a broadcast career, he switched to education, starting the broadcast program at the St. Charles Parish Public Schools Satellite Center and then transitioned to Loyola University in New Orleans.
While in education, he continued to work freelance as a videographer for the Saints “Outside the Huddle” show and then as a freelance replay and camera operator for the Saints and Pelicans. He has worked two Super Bowls and multiple NCAA National Championship games.
Albert is from Houma, Louisiana, a graduate of Nicholls State University, and lives in Kenner.
